A friend of mine just sent me this story of his POW bear.


Here is a few quick shots of my bear hunt on Prince of Whales Island this spring. We went over Memorial Day weekend and did it all ourselves. No Outfitter. This was the second time I've been there and for an area that gets over 135" of rain a year we did not get any rain during daylight hours on either trip. Very lucky. The bugs were not really a problem either. We had two crab pots out during this hunt and caught between 5-8 legal crabs every day. We boiled them for 12 minutes and then ate them without butter or any seasoning and they were fantastic. We dug clams and ate them as well. My friend Chuck killed a 6' Boar with a skull of 18 5/16". He made a fantastic shot and the bears hide was better than average for the island. On the second to last day I killed this bear who squared 6'6" and had a skull of 18 10/16". I was fortunate enough to make a very fatal shot on the bear and he died less than 40 yards from my tree and was completely done in less than 7 seconds. Unbelievable! We saw tons of seal and even got in the middle of a pod of 15 Killer Whales. Very close to them is an understatement. We were in a 14' Lund with a 15 Horse motor. They didn't like us so close and actually followed us for a little bit!! HUGE DORSAL FIN IN OUR ROOSTER TAIL......well at lease as much of a rooster tail that a 15 horse can throw.
